You sure you've got a dump valve mate? You've still got the stock recirc valve pipe work going into the inlet?
 
You got a pic of the valve? Should be near the throttle body.
I think you might just be getting the noise of the recirc valve through the filter which of course sounds awesome :)
 
Yes easily.

So if there isnt a dump valve on it, could that noise be coming from something else thats been modified? Could this be effecting the MPG?

No, recirc valves and dump valves dont affect mpg.
And the only reason you can hear it is because of the induction kit, thats what the stock recirc valve sounds like.
The stock airbox takes the noise away completely.
